The latest update for 1password broke the SSH agent integration with the application GitExtensions

After updating 1password, I noticed that the SSH prompts show a nice little icon but it completely borked the ssh integration with Git Extensions version Git Extensions 4.0.2.16100. I just never get a prompt and it hangs.


1Password Version: 1Password for Windows 8.10.4 (81004032)
Extension Version: Not Provided
OS Version: Windows 22621.1555

    To bypass it, I have to use a known app such as VS Code, approve access for all applications then it works.

    We're looking into a fix for this. In the mean time, if you have Windows Hello enabled, you can revert to the old prompts by disabling the Use rich approval prompt setting in the 1Password Developer settings.

    Could you update to the latest version of 1Password app and let us know if the issue still persists?

    If the issue is still present, can you click the 1Password icon in the app tray and check to see if there's a menu entry called "SSH Request waiting"? I suspect clicking it should bring up the SSH authorization prompt.
